A good PCB layout for the AQG22112 involves keeping the signal paths short, using a solid ground plane, and minimizing the distance between the IC and the antenna. A 4-layer PCB with a dedicated ground plane is recommended.
To ensure the AQG22112 operates within the specified temperature range, make sure to provide adequate heat dissipation, avoid overheating, and use a thermal interface material (TIM) if necessary. The operating temperature range is -40°C to 125°C.
For optimal performance, use a 10uF ceramic capacitor and a 100nF ceramic capacitor in parallel, placed as close as possible to the VCC pin. This helps to filter out noise and ensure stable operation.
To troubleshoot wireless communication issues, check the antenna design and placement, ensure the correct frequency and modulation settings, and verify the transmission power and data rate. Use a spectrum analyzer or a protocol analyzer to debug the issue.
The recommended antenna design for the AQG22112 is a 1/4 wavelength monopole antenna or a chip antenna with a 50Ω impedance. The antenna should be placed at least 10mm away from the IC and other components to minimize interference.
